Как построены серверные операционные системы
Серверные операционные системы представляют собой специализированное программное обеспечение для регулирования физическими средствами компьютера. Конструкция таких систем строится на основе многозадачности и многопользовательского доступа. Ядро организует функционирование процессора, операционной памяти, дисковых накопителей и сетевых интерфейсов.
Базу образует модульная архитектура, где каждый блок реализует заданные задачи. Драйверы обеспечивают взаимодействие с материальным аппаратурой. Планировщик задач делит вычислительные возможности между задачами. Файловая система структурирует хранение информации на носителях.
Серверная вавада содержит модули для обслуживания сетевых соединений и старта приложений. Системные библиотеки обеспечивают процессам подготовленные методы для операций с ресурсами. Системы разделения задач исключают коллизии между процессами.
Интерфейс командной строки дает операторам конфигурировать настройки и проверять положение системы. Журналы событий сохраняют данные о функционировании блоков зеркало вавада. Такая структура предоставляет стабильную деятельность оборудования под высокой нагруженностью.
Чем серверная ОС отличается от обычной
Ключевое отличие кроется в предназначении и способе использования. Десктопные системы предназначены на работу одного оператора с оконными программами. Серверные платформы обрабатывают массу concurrent коннектов и исполняют скрытые задачи без вмешательства человека.
Графический интерфейс в серверных версиях часто отсутствует или упрощен. Управление осуществляется через командную строку и установочные документы. Такой вариант уменьшает затраты возможностей и улучшает быстродействие. Пользовательские варианты обеспечивают визуальные утилиты для обычных операций.
Серверные системы поддерживают улучшенные функции расширения. Решения vavada функционируют с значительными количествами памяти и совокупностью процессорных ядер. Надежность и бесперебойность функционирования критически существенны для серверного программного обеспечения. Системы конструируются для круглосуточного работы без перезапусков. Механизмы дублирования предохраняют от ошибок. Пользовательские версии допускают систематические рестарты и менее взыскательны к отказоустойчивости.
Основные задачи серверных систем
Серверные системы выполняют спектр целей по гарантированию работы сетевых служб и программ:
- Осуществление поступающих сетевых подключений и маршрутизация данных.
- Запуск и надзор деятельности прикладных утилит и веб-сервисов.
- Выделение процессорной ресурсов между работающими задачами.
- Контроль положения физических блоков и системных модулей.
- Создание журналов событий для оценки производительности.
Программное обеспечение организует коммуникацию между пользовательскими терминалами и вычислительными возможностями. Структура обеспечивает параллельно осуществлять тысячи запросов от разных пользователей.
Размещение и управление информацией составляет главную цель серверных платформ. Файловые накопители организуют подключение к документам, медиафайлам и резервам. Системы управления базами данных выполняют систематизированную информацию. Средства архивного копирования защищают ценные информацию от исчезновения.
Система обеспечивает изоляцию клиентских контекстов и приложений. Виртуализация дает активировать несколько независимых казино вавада на одном аппаратном узле. Распределение загрузки делит задания между имеющимися возможностями для наилучшей производительности.
Как выполняются запросы пользователей
Процесс обработки стартует с получения обращения через сетевой интерфейс. Входящее подключение направляется в буфер, где дожидается своей черед. Сетевой слой изучает блоки информации и определяет назначенный модуль. Маршрутизатор отправляет запрос соответствующему программному компоненту.
Сервис извлекает информацию и осуществляет требуемые процедуры. Приложение может обратиться к файловой системе для извлечения или сохранения данных. База данных возвращает искомые записи. Процессорные процедуры реализуются процессором в соответствии с приоритету задачи.
Многопоточная структура обеспечивает обрабатывать множество обращений параллельно. Каждое коннект приобретает собственный нить исполнения. Планировщик выделяет процессорное время между работающими задачами. Серверная вавада отслеживает применение памяти и предотвращает исчерпание возможностей.
Сформированный результат высылается обратно заказчику через сетевое канал. Протоколы транспортного уровня гарантируют передачу сведений. Протокол регистрирует сведения о произведенной действии и состоянии завершения. Освобожденные ресурсы становятся готовыми для очередных запросов.
Контроль средствами и нагруженностью
Грамотное выделение возможностей предоставляет надежную функционирование всех служб. Диспетчер операций устанавливает важности задач и распределяет вычислительное время. Схемы распределения пресекают переполнение индивидуальных блоков. Контроль контролирует текущее статус техники в настоящем времени.
Оперативная память распределяется между активными программами гибко. Система свопинга использует дисковое объем при дефиците реальной памяти. Кэширование повышает доступ к часто используемым данным. Автоматизированная сборка очищает неиспользуемые зоны памяти.
Дисковые процедуры ускоряются через списки запросов и упреждающее чтение. Файловая система кластеризует ассоциированные данные для минимизации времени подключения. Серверные vavada поддерживают горячую замену дисков без остановки функционирования.
Сетевая модуль управляет пропускную емкость магистралей передачи. Регулирование скорости предотвращает монополизацию bandwidth конкретными подключениями. Ранжирование потока обеспечивает качество работы важных сервисов. Аналитика загрузки помогает планировать расширение системы.
Безопасность и надзор входа
Охрана данных и ресурсов строится на иерархической системе разграничения прав. Каждый пользователь обретает индивидуальный код и совокупность полномочий. Аутентификация проверяет достоверность регистрационных записей при авторизации. Пароли содержатся в закодированном состоянии для предотвращения запрещенного доступа.
Права подключения к документам и папкам регулируются персонально для каждого ресурса. Владелец объекта определяет допустимые операции для иных пользователей. Коллективы объединяют учетные аккаунты с идентичными правами. Серверная казино вавада останавливает действия реализации неразрешенных действий.
Firewall брандмауэр фильтрует приходящий и отправляемый трафик по определенным параметрам. Списки управления блокируют подключения с указанных IP-адресов. Системы обнаружения атак изучают странную активность. Криптование предохраняет пересылаемую данные от прослушивания.
Протоколы безопасности регистрируют все старания доступа к ограниченным элементам. Аудит событий помогает выявить отклонения стандартов. Самостоятельные сообщения оповещают управляющих о критических событиях. Регулярное корректировка критериев приспосабливает решение к актуальным угрозам.
Деятельность с сетью и соединениями
Сетевая модуль предоставляет взаимодействие сервера с удаленными терминалами и иными узлами. Сетевые интерфейсы получают и пересылают информацию по различным протоколам. Драйверы адаптеров управляют материальными интерфейсами. Настройка IP-адресов устанавливает идентификацию узла в сети.
Стек протоколов TCP/IP обрабатывает транспортировку данных на множественных слоях. Маршрутизация отправляет блоки к назначенным точкам через кратчайшие маршруты. DNS-резолвер переводит доменные имена в цифровые адреса. DHCP автоматизированно распределяет сетевые настройки подсоединенным терминалам.
Администрирование коннектами охватывает отслеживание открытых подключений и таймаутов. Резервы соединений многократно задействуют активные каналы для сохранения средств. Серверные вавада обеспечивают тысячи синхронных TCP-соединений благодаря результативным методам. Балансировщики распределяют поступающий данные между множественными серверами.
Контроль сетевой поведения проверяет транспортную способность и латентность. Проверочные средства контролируют доступность внешних машин. Метрики интерфейсов выдает размеры отправленных данных и количество сбоев. Настройка очередей повышает эффективность при множественных видах нагруженности.
Патчи и сопровождение решения
Систематическое апдейт программного обеспечения обеспечивает защищенность и надежность деятельности. Авторы выпускают исправления для исправления дыр и дефектов. Системы пакетов механизируют получение и развертывание обновлений. Управляющие проектируют использование правок в периоды низкой нагрузки.
Испытание обновлений на отдельных площадках блокирует неожиданные ошибки. Архивное дублирование параметров обеспечивает быстро отменить корректировки при неполадках. Серверная vavada обеспечивает системы возврата к прошлым релизам модулей.
Наблюдение состояния контролирует наличие актуальных версий утилит и компонентов. Сообщения информируют о приоритетных патчах охраны. Автоматизированные сканирования находят старые элементы. Политики апдейта назначают первоочередности и периоды развертывания изменений.
Техническая обслуживание вендоров предлагает консультации по настраиванию и исправлению ошибок. Коммьюнити пользователей распространяет знаниями решения задач. Репозитории сведений включают указания по управлению. Платные контракты обеспечивают предоставление патчей в продолжение определенного времени.
Где используются серверные операционные системы
Веб-хостинг составляет одну из главных направлений эксплуатации серверных систем. Организации располагают ресурсы и веб-приложения на dedicated или виртуализованных узлах. Системы выполняют HTTP-запросы от миллионов клиентов постоянно.
Корпоративные сети опираются на серверную базу для размещения информации и старта бизнес-приложений. Файловые серверы обеспечивают консолидированный обращение к материалам. Почтовые платформы выполняют переписку фирмы. Базы данных содержат данные о покупателях и финансовых транзакциях.
Облачные провайдеры строят расширяемые системы на базе серверных платформ. Виртуализация дает генерировать изолированные среды для разных пользователей. Серверные казино вавада обеспечивают адаптивность и производительность облачных услуг.
Академические операции нуждаются высокопроизводительных серверных ферм для выполнения больших объемов сведений. Научные организации моделируют комплексные операции. Медицинские учреждения сохраняют цифровые досье пациентов на защищенных серверах. Обучающие системы дают подключение к учебным контенту.

